During 2024, you can take up to eight weeks of Paid Family Leave and receive 50% of your average weekly wage (AWW), capped at 50% of the New York State Average Weekly Wage (SAWW). Your AWW is the average of your last eight weeks of pay prior to starting Paid Family Leave. The SAWW is updated annually. WebThere is a seven day waiting period for which no benefits are paid. Benefits begin on the eighth consecutive day of disability (WCL §208). Disability Benefits Law, or DBL for short, provides NY state-mandated short-term disability insurance benefits to covered employees who can’t work due to a non-work-related injury, illness, or due to pregnancy/birth of a baby. DBL is a required benefit for NY employers, typically private sector employers ...

The NY DBL pays weekly cash benefits to employees employed in New York who cannot work due to an off-the-job injury or illness. Unemployed workers can also receive NY DBL benefits to replace unemployment insurance benefits lost because of illness or injury. iot encrypted trafficWebDisability benefits are temporary cash benefits paid to an eligible employee, when they are disabled by an off-the-job injury or illness. Disability benefits are equal to 50 percent of the employee's average weekly wage for the last eight weeks worked, with a maximum benefit of $170 per week (WCL §204).
